Phantom Of The Opera
Her Majesty’s Theatre, London
September 1994 – September 1995

Music by Andrew Lloyd Webber
Lyrics by Charles Hart
Additional lyrics by Richard Stilgoe

Original Direction by Harold Prince
Musical Staging by Gillian Lynne

Resident Director Goeffrey Ferris
Musical Director Richard Balcombe
